Here’s a bright idea that promotes the dream of uniting passionate people in sharing an important messages around our food system.
It’s called Give a Fork! and Sustainable Table, the people behind it, want to spread their message in a fun and non-confronting way, because let’s face it, we’re all a little bit tired of the eye-rolls we get for being that person at the dinner party who asks if the chicken is free range or politely declines the factory farmed pork chop.
Give a Fork! is the perfect way to engage passionate people as well as their friends and families with those prickly issues in a relaxed and fun way.
This year’s theme is sustainable seafood, chosen because it’s one of the least understood areas of our food system.
This is despite the ocean sustaining life on our planet, delivering half of our oxygen and providing an estimated $20 trillion worth of natural resources and services a year
Here’s how it works., you get a group of friends together during 7-14th of October and host a sustainable seafood dinner party.
Hosts will receive a free host pack and all the resources to cook a delicious sustainable seafood dinner.
Some of the resources in the pack include; a Sustainable Seafood e-Cookbook, A Fishy Business DVD to show on the night, 5 Steps to Sustainability placemats, a Switch your Fish guide and much more.
Get hooked on the issues so that you can make ethical and environmentally conscious decisions when it comes to consuming seafood.
Vegetarians can still participate and the e-Cookbook features a selection of vegetarian recipes, as Barton Seaver once said, “Want to save more fish? Eat more broccoli!”
the idea is that participants ask their friends to donate what they would’ve spent on a night out.
The money raised will help Sustainable Table to continue their important work of building a fair and sustainable food system by providing endless free and helpful resources, educational events and by supporting sustainable development projects locally and abroad.
